by Emma Nesper
Wednesday, May 8, 2002
Tuesday night members of Associated Students of Madison met to recommend the appointees to the ASM Financial Committee and the Student Segregated Fees Committee.
After passage of a bylaw requiring ASM screening of candidates for these committees at the final meeting of ASM’s eighth session, the seven judges interviewed 22 of the 24 applicants.
“[Applicants] needed to have experience that was applicable to the real world, whether it be through student groups or other budgetary experience,” said ASM Vice Chair Emily McWilliams.
The delegating committee said budgetary experience and previous involvement in student organizations are required for consideration, though experience with both is not necessary.
“To be on SSFC or FC you must have some working knowledge of what these committees do,” McWilliams said.
ASM Chair Bryan Gadow and L&S representative Carl Camacho both said they were excited about the applicant pool.
“The general pool was very balanced this year,” Gadow said. “There were a lot of people with various experience.”
Camacho said they chose the most qualified and representative students.
“The people chosen in the end were very qualified,” Gadow added.
The four appointees for SSFC are Mark Baumgardner, Cate Dobyns, and former ASM members Jason Davis and Faith Kurtyka.
The five individuals appointed to serve on the Financial Committee are Louis Agnello, Fatima Ashras, Brad Schuth, Steve Singh and Rob Welygan.
Camacho said he and the other judges were required to select the representatives for these committees this week because SSFC meets Thursday to select its chair. The Financial Committee will meet at a later date to internally select its chair.
